The Falwells wanted to keep “a bunch of photographs, personal photographs” from becoming public, Cohen told Arnold. “I actually have one of the photos,” he said, without going into specifics. “It’s terrible.”
According to Reuters, the Falwells told Cohen that "someone" had acquired the pictures and was asking them for money; Cohen met with the would-be blackmailer's attorney(?) and warned him that his client's actions amounted to a crime. The unnamed "someone" then allegedly destroyed the pictures and the matter was dropped.
It is left scrupulously unclear in the report as to just what the pictures show or who is in them. Falwell approached Cohen for help in 2015; it's not clear whether it was before or after Trump had announced his candidacy. Reuters also helpfully notes that they found "no evidence" that Falwell's extremely, very damn odd endorsement of sleazy gross person Donald Trump the next year had anything to do with the picture that Michael Cohen appears to still have in his possession.
